+15 lunchtime consumer since 1995 and shawarma enthusiast. I feel like we have a new downtown shawarma champion. Fast service with a huge line up, super fresh and crisp ingredients. The chicken had great flavour and a good char and was not dried out. Many places pre cut and have the chicken sitting in a warming oven, this service was hand cutting or order so you get that off the oven grill. My normal downtown go-2’s for shawarma are Olly Fresco’s and Pita Express but this may just replace them as my new #1.
